Wider weather episode

A strong cold front moved across VT during the late afternoon and evening hours of October 16th. Preceding the cold front a line of strong showers with some embedded thunderstorms moved into a very strongly sheared environment with southerly winds in excess of 60 mph around 5000 feet. A few of these stronger showers and thunderstorms tapped into those low-level winds and caused some isolated wind damage, mainly in the form of small, softwood trees begin toppled over by the wind.
